7. Find the sum of the interior angles of the following polygons.

a) A Hexagon b) A Decagon c) A Heptagon


8. The exterior angles of regular polygons are given below. In each case find the number of
sides.

a) 18° b) 45° c) 3°

9. Find the value of each interior angle of the following regular polygons.

a) Octagon b) A 12-sided polygon c) Heptagon

10. Find the umber of sides of the regular polygons in which the size of each interior angles
is given below.

a) 108° b) 156 ° c) 171°
